5. SAVING. To avoid being in a frustrating situation, it is advisable to save your work in a word-processing program. Imagine yourself working on a report, and losing everything you've worked on because of a network error. The error could be from the COOLSchool end, or on yours. In either case, you will not be excused from the assignment, and must begin again. Avoid this by doing your assignments (it may only be necessary to do this on the longer assignments that require a report/essay) in a word-processing program. Save early, save often. When you are done in the word-processing program, simply copy and paste into the correct area when you are submitting your assignment.
